I'm having problems with smb streaming (as others seem to have). It starts off fine but then becomes very "laggy". This is with all of the caches set to their maximums in guisettings.xml.

The videos are on a NAS with upnp, smb, and ftp servers, and none of the folders are being indexed as I have them set to private to avoid this.

SMB streaming seems to start out fine (I can see it pulling down 1.2mb/s), but it quickly slows down and the video and audio become choppy. UPNP behaves similarly, although it never reaches 1.2mb/s. These same videos stream fine when the smb share is mounted in os x (thru QuickLook, vlc, whatever...). They also stream fine to my iPhone using upnp (with PlugPlayer). Given that they stream fine in these other situations, it seems odd to say that it's my connection's fault (wireless g).

I'm currently using ftp. It is working better, but the videos still stop to load or buffer throughout the episode.

Let me know if some logs would be of help with this. Increasing the size of the cache seemed to me to be the best bet, but it hasn't helped. I'd be happy to hear of any other suggestions.

Im not sure of the reason that you are having this issue - some people seem to have lots of probs with the boxee built in SMB client, whilst others (myself included) dont have any problems.

Personally, I use a script to automount my shares in OS X upon login, and then boxee just sees the local mounts.

I should add at that pointing it at the locally mounted samba share solved the problem. I'm not sure why it didn't the first time I tried that. The only difference is that I no longer have boxee index my media. Perhaps it was trying to index things as I was testing out videos. All's well now.
